Some people participate in the stock market to trade for short-term gains (traders), while others invest for long-term gains (investors). Traders rely on short-term price movements, charts and market signals. Investors rely primarily on business fundamentals and long-term value. These are two completely different strategies and one has to decide which approach they are following. Neither of you is right or wrong, you are simply playing different games.
